Notre Dame Cathedral Paris, often called Cathédrale Notre-Dame de Paris, can be a masterpiece of Gothic architecture in France. It stands to the eastern end of the Île de la Cité, a small island inside the Seine River. The cathedral was designed more than two hundreds of years, starting in 1163 and ending in 1345. It replaced two earlier church buildings constructed on the site of a Roman temple devoted to Jupiter. Notre-Dame Cathedral Paris provides a choir and apse, a brief transept, as well as a nave flanked by double aisles and sq. chapels. The roof is supported by flying buttresses, that are exterior arches that allow the walls to generally be thinner and possess huge Home windows. The cathedral has 3 rose Home windows, that happen to be round stained-glass Home windows that depict scenes in the Bible along with the church’s heritage. The Home windows are amongst the greatest masterpieces of Christianity. The western facade from the Notre Dame Cathedral Paris has two towers which might be 223 feet (68 meters) substantial.

The towers had been alleged to have spires, but they had been in no way extra. The facade has three portals, or doors, decorated with sculptures and carvings. The portals demonstrate the tales with the Virgin Mary, the final Judgement, and St. Anne, the mom of Mary. Over the portals, There exists a row of statues with the kings of Judah, who were being mistaken with the kings of France during the French Revolution and beheaded. Notre Dame Cathedral Paris has witnessed several critical gatherings during the historical past of France, like the coronation of Napoleon Bonaparte, the funeral of Charles de Gaulle, along with the celebration on the liberation of Paris from Nazi occupation. It's also a symbol of French lifestyle and identification as well as Architects in Cheshire a source of inspiration for artists and writers. The cathedral was seriously harmed by a fire in 2019, which wrecked the roof and the nineteenth-century spire. The cathedral’s restoration is anticipated to become completed by 2024, the calendar year in the Paris Olympics.

The expression 'seismic architecture' or 'earthquake architecture' was to start with introduced in 1985 by Robert Reitherman.[53] The phrase "earthquake architecture" is employed to explain a diploma of architectural expression of earthquake resistance or implication of architectural configuration, kind or model in earthquake resistance. It is also utilized to describe properties wherein seismic design factors impacted its architecture.

The development of the Notre Dame Cathedral Paris commenced in 1163 and was done all-around 1345. It absolutely was a collaborative exertion involving quite a few proficient craftsmen, together with learn masons, sculptors, and stained glass artists. The cathedral is recognized for its Gothic architectural design, characterized by pointed arches, ribbed vaults, and traveling buttresses, which permitted for taller and even more intricate designs.
